    TomTom's Safety Related Traffic Information (SRTI) API is a webservice that delivers anonymized non-personal raw data on hazardous situations directly collected by TomTom's own applications. The content of the API includes anonymized, non-personal, crowd-sourced data from drivers using TomTom's AmiGO application that reports 'hazards' and 'broken down car' incidents on the road. In accordance with EU Regulation 886/2013, this data is accessible to other users and can be integrated in other applications to improve road safety conditions. The access and use of this data are laid out in our terms and conditions. The service delivers safety messages for the area of the European Union in the form of a RESTful web service. The content contains information based on sensor or end-user feedback.

    This is a dynamic traffic map service with capabilities for visualizing traffic speeds relative to free-flow speeds as well as traffic incidents which can be visualized and identified. The traffic data is updated every five minutes. Traffic speeds are displayed as a percentage of free-flow speeds, which is frequently the speed limit or how fast cars tend to travel when unencumbered by other vehicles. The streets are color coded as follows: Green (fast): 85 - 100% of free flow speeds Yellow (moderate): 65 - 85% Orange (slow); 45 - 65% Red (stop and go): 0 - 45%Esri's historical, live, and predictive traffic feeds come directly from TomTom (www.tomtom.com). Historical traffic is based on the average of observed speeds over the past year. The live and predictive traffic data is updated every five minutes through traffic feeds. The color coded traffic map layer can be used to represent relative traffic speeds; this is a common type of a map for online services and is used to provide context for routing, navigation and field operations. The traffic map layer contains two sublayers: Traffic and Live Traffic. The Traffic sublayer (shown by default) leverages historical, live and predictive traffic data; while the Live Traffic sublayer is calculated from just the live and predictive traffic data only. A color coded traffic map image can be requested for the current time and any time in the future. A map image for a future request might be used for planning purposes. The map layer also includes dynamic traffic incidents showing the location of accidents, construction, closures and other issues that could potentially impact the flow of traffic. Traffic incidents are commonly used to provide context for routing, navigation and field operations. Incidents are not features; they cannot be exported and stored for later use or additional analysis. The service works globally and can be used to visualize traffic speeds and incidents in many countries. Check the service coverage web map to determine availability in your area of interest. In the coverage map, the countries color coded in dark green support visualizing live traffic. The support for traffic incidents can be determined by identifying a country. For detailed information on this service, including a data coverage map, visit the directions and routing documentation and ArcGIS Help.

    According to a recent report released by TomTom, drivers during the rush hour commute can expect congestion levels to significantly increase their commute time. On average, drivers will spend double the time in the car for most large metropolitan areas across the world during the evening commute alone. The average commuter spent an extra 100 hours a year traveling during the evening rush hour.In Los Angeles (Ranked 1st in the United States (U.S.) and 10th Worldwide), a 30 minute commute in the evening will take 54 minutes due to congestion, an extra 92 hours annually. Commuters in the San Francisco Bay Region are only slightly better off than their counter parts in Los Angeles. The measured congestion in San Francisco (Ranked 2nd in the U.S. and 26th Worldwide) is at 34%, while San Jose (Ranked 6th in the U.S. and 51st Worldwide) is at 30%.TomTom roadway congestion is measured as an increase in overall travel times when compared to the posted speed limits on roadways. For example, a Congestion Level of 12% corresponds to 12% longer travel times. The latest results and press release can be viewed here: https://www.tomtom.com/traffic-index/

    🇩🇪 독일 German We developed TomTom Intermediate Traffic to deliver detailed, real-time traffic content to business customers who integrate it into their own applications. Target customers for TomTom Intermediate Traffic include automotive OEMs, web and application developers, and governments. We deliver bulk traffic flow information that provides a comprehensive view of the entire road network. TomTom delivered our first live traffic product in 2007 and our experience has taught us how to continue delivering the best traffic products in the market. Our real-time traffic products are created by merging multiple data sources, including anonymized measurement data from over 650 million GPS-enabled devices. Using highly granular data, gathered on nearly every stretch of road, we can calculate travel times and speeds for virtually any day or time. We focus on our travel information so our customers can focus on their own business objectives.

    TomTom has long been a trusted name in GPS navigation, offering reliable devices that help drivers reach their destinations with confidence. From standalone GPS units to built-in systems in vehicles, TomTom has remained a favorite for those who value precision, ease of use, and helpful features. However, like all technology that relies on changing data, a TomTom GPS must be updated regularly to remain effective. Roads change, speed limits are revised, new businesses open, and old routes may close. Without regular updates, even the most advanced GPS device can become outdated and inaccurate.

    Updating your TomTom GPS map ensures you’re navigating with the latest and most precise data available. Whether you're commuting to work, planning a road trip, or driving through unfamiliar territory, up-to-date maps can save time, reduce stress, and help you avoid unnecessary detours. The good news is that updating your TomTom GPS is a relatively straightforward process that anyone can do with a little preparation and the right tools.

    Understanding Your TomTom Device

    Before beginning the update process, it's essential to understand what kind of TomTom device you own. TomTom offers several models, including portable navigation devices, built-in car systems, and smartphone apps. While the basic process of updating remains similar, specific steps may vary depending on the model and the software it uses.

    Most modern TomTom devices use either the MyDrive Connect application or TomTom Home software to manage updates. These platforms allow users to download and install the latest maps, software updates, and other features directly from TomTom’s servers. Knowing which software your device requires is the first step in the update process.

    Preparing for the Update

    To update your TomTom GPS, you will need a computer with an internet connection, a USB cable to connect your device, and enough storage space to accommodate the update files. These files can be quite large, especially if you are updating maps for an entire continent or multiple regions, so a fast and stable internet connection is recommended.

    Ensure your GPS device is fully charged or connected to a power source during the update process. Interruptions caused by a power failure or disconnection can lead to incomplete updates or device malfunctions.

    Installing the Correct Software

    Once you're ready, you’ll need to install the appropriate update software. TomTom provides two main applications for device management. MyDrive Connect is used for newer devices, while TomTom Home supports older models. After installing the correct software on your computer, open the program and follow the prompts to connect your GPS device using the USB cable.

    Upon successful connection, the software will recognize your device and check for available updates. This may include new maps, system updates, or other features such as voice commands or interface improvements. The interface is user-friendly and designed to guide users through the update process without requiring technical expertise.

    Downloading the Latest Maps

    After the software detects the available updates, you’ll be given the option to download the latest map files. These updates may include new roads, updated traffic data, corrected routing errors, and additional points of interest such as restaurants, gas stations, and public services.

    The download process can take time, especially if the map data covers a large geographical area. It’s best to avoid using your computer for bandwidth-heavy tasks during this process. The software will display the progress and notify you when the download is complete.

    Installing the Update on Your GPS

    Once the download is finished, the next step is to install the update on your TomTom device. The software usually handles this automatically. During installation, your GPS may restart or show a progress bar. It’s crucial not to disconnect or power off the device during this stage. Interrupting the installation could corrupt the data or render your device temporarily unusable.

    After installation is complete, the device will typically reboot and apply the new settings. It’s a good idea to verify the new map version by checking the system information or map details from the settings menu on your device.

    Updating Maps Through Wi-Fi

    Many newer TomTom devices support Wi-Fi updates, eliminating the need for a computer. If your device offers this feature, you can connect it directly to a wireless network. Once connected, navigate to the update section within the settings menu, where the device will search for available updates and prompt you to download and install them. This method is especially convenient and saves time, though it still requires a strong and stable internet connection.

    Keeping Your Maps Current

    TomTom recommends checking for updates regularly. Some devices come with a lifetime map update feature, allowing users to receive updates free of charge for the life of the device. Others may require a subscription or one-time payment, especially if you’re adding maps for new regions or countries.

    Staying current with map updates not only enhances your navigation experience but also ensures your device remains compatible with the latest features and performance improvements. It also reduces the risk of getting lost or delayed due to outdated routes or missing data.

    Benefits of Regular Updates

    Beyond improved accuracy, regular map updates provide access to new roads, better routing options, and updated traffic information. They can also improve the overall performance of your device, including faster route calculations and smoother interface interactions.

    Frequent updates can also be crucial for those using TomTom for business or professional driving, where time efficiency and route accuracy are critical. Even for casual drivers, updated maps contribute to safer and more enjoyable journeys.

    Final Thoughts

    Updating your TomTom GPS map is a simple yet essential task that ensures your navigation experience remains accurate and efficient. With a bit of time and the right tools, you can keep your device performing at its best, no matter where your travels take you. By making regular updates part of your vehicle maintenance routine, you’re not only protecting your investment but also ensuring a more informed, safe, and stress-free journey every time you hit the road.

Recent developments include: June 2024: TomTom (TOM2), a location technology company, partnered with Miovision, specializing in traffic management technologies. This partnership aims to enhance traffic signal analytics and in-vehicle solutions, ultimately reducing congestion and emissions while bolstering public safety. Miovision's innovations include the Audi Traffic Light Information system, a pioneering technology that guides drivers to bypass red lights at optimal speeds. By integrating TomTom's traffic data, Miovision's solutions will benefit from enriched real-time and historical traffic flow insights at intersections.March 2024: Thales partnered with Neural Labs, a provider of video analysis solutions for Smart Cities and AI-driven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S). This partnership aims to deliver efficient, secure, and significant solutions for vehicle access control and logistical planning. Leveraging Thales's Sentinel platform, which specializes in software licensing, entitlement management, delivery, and protection, Neural Labs has streamlined license creation and issuance automation.August 2024: CV Sync, one of the monitored traffic technology upgrades, Q-Free's advanced traffic management system (ATMS) harmonises traffic across nearly a dozen communities in California's Coachella Valley. The CV Sync project comprehensively overhauls the region's outdated signal controllers and traffic management systems. This upgrade integrates the latest, off-the-shelf Intelligent Transportation Systems technologies, incorporates cybersecurity measures, and establishes a new regional traffic management centre complemented by several local traffic operations centres..     The real-time traffic information providers industry in the UK has undergone a substantial transformation amid the technological revolution, solidifying its role as a vital service for modern consumers. The uptake in smartphone usage combined with dwindling mobile prices has made real-time traffic data easily accessible to many users. Despite the temporary setback brought on by the pandemic, with driving miles dropping significantly, the industry rebounded quickly as normalcy returned, highlighting its resilience and essential nature in day-to-day commuting and commercial logistics. Revenue is estimated to improve by 2.7% in 2024-25. Industry revenue is anticipated to hike at a compound annual rate of 2.4% over the five years through 2024-25, to £98.8 million. The industry's growth has been primarily driven by sophisticated technological methods and strategic partnerships. Traffic information is now sourced from millions of data points encompassing taxis, smartphones, registered vehicles and traditional road sensors. This growing data compilation and necessary computer infrastructure have permeated virtually every aspect of travel in the UK. Notable providers like HERE and INRIX have formed alliances with automotive giants and mobile companies, integrating their services into preinstalled vehicle GPS systems and popular phone mapping applications. These collaborations and the increasing volume of real-time traffic data have necessitated a higher investment in research and development, albeit at the cost of restricted profit growth amid heightened wage expenditures and continuous technological advancements. Industry revenue is projected to grow at a compound annual rate of 2.9% over the five years through 2029-30, to reach £113.8 million. Providers are expected to extend their geographical coverage and enhance the granularity of their offerings, providing deeper insights into road conditions in smaller towns and villages. With disposable incomes recovering after the cost-of-living crisis, consumers' interest in well-enabled cars is likely to climb, supporting revenue. Companies like HERE plan to diversify revenue streams via mobile advertising platforms, elevating monetisation through targeted ads. However, talent acquisition will remain a pressing challenge, spurred by a constricted talent pool and immigration barriers, necessitating innovative recruitment strategies in a competitive landscape.
